Clay-heavy soil like Bartow County's can trap water, but we install a engineered base that sits on top of your native soil—not mixed into it. We use proper grading and a perforated drainage layer so winter rains and snowmelt move through quickly instead of pooling. This keeps the turf stable and prevents that spongy, muddy feel you'd get with poor drainage underneath.
